Chips and Tips Event: Affordable Pet Care in Clinton

May 1, 2024

Attention pet owners! Mark your calendars for the upcoming Chips and Tips Event on Saturday, May 4, 2024, from 2pm to 3pm at 793 Poplar Street in Clinton. This event hosted by the Laurens County Humane Society offers a range of essential pet services at special discounted rates, aimed at ensuring the health and well-being of our furry friends.

The event will feature a variety of services including nail trims, vaccinations (such as rabies, DHPP, and Bordetella), microchipping, heartworm testing and prevention, flea/tick medication, feline vaccinations, and deworming treatments. Here’s a breakdown of the services and costs:

  • Nail Trim – $10
  • Rabies Vaccination – $10
  • DHPP Vaccination – $15
  • Bordetella Vaccination – $12
  • Microchipping – $20
  • Heartworm Testing – $14
  • Heartworm Prevention (1 month) – $10/pill
  • Flea/Tick Medication (1 month) – $20/pill
  • Feline FVRCP Vaccination – $12
  • Dewormer (hooks/rounds) – $5
